A Sacred Space: Mosquee Assalam
Mosquee Assalam, established in 1999, stands as a vital hub for Nantes' Muslim community, promoting cultural and spiritual understanding.
Founded by local Muslim leaders, its architecture reflects traditional Islamic design while serving the city's need for a place of worship. The mosque hosts various community events, contributing significantly to intercultural dialogue in the region.
